Frequently asked questions about Sampson Community College

Quick answers to the questions most often asked about Sampson Community College.

What is the graduation rate at Sampson Community College?

Sampson Community College reports a 6-year graduation rate of 56% per the latest IPEDS.

How many students attend Sampson Community College?

Sampson Community College reports a total enrollment of 1,526 students per the latest IPEDS.

What is the average net price at Sampson Community College?

The average net price at Sampson Community College is $3,826 per the latest College Scorecard. Net price is the published cost of attendance minus grant aid.

Where is Sampson Community College located?

Sampson Community College is located in Clinton, North Carolina 28328-0318.
